NTT DATA seeks a Lead Database Architect for a proposal effort scheduled for award in late 2025.

The Lead Database Architect will provide oversight for multiple technical and functional database administrators. Design database, warehouse, sharing, integration, and security based on both state and federal requirements. Participate in planning business intelligence and analytics systems. Provide oversight of the development of data models, data taxonomy, and data standards used by project teams. Maintain data health and performance across the supported enterprise. Provide research into products, tools, processes, and procedures to identify innovations to improve quality and performance of data.
